Highlights
Are people in Needham older or younger than people in Sherborn?
- The Median Age in Needham is 1.9 years younger than in Sherborn.

Are housing costs cheaper in Needham or Sherborn?
- Needham housing costs are 27.1% more expensive than Sherborn hous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Needham or Sherborn?
- The average commute for residents of Needham is 6.4 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Sherborn.
